- By Clare Charles.
This exam companion provides students with the understanding they need to approach the AQA-A AS Level Psychology exam with confidence. Full of expert advice to help students achieve their best, the companion provides:
- A range of example exam questions, which cover all of the topics on the specification
- A set of model answers to these questions
- Examiner advice which highlights key mistakes that can be made
- Advice on Assessment Objectives where relevant, to emphasise how the AO1, AO2, and AO3 skills are assessed.
A full range of short answer questions is also provided, including the new style Application of Knowledge and Research Methods questions. Written by an experienced teacher, author and examiner, the AS Psychology Exam Companion goes beyond revision notes to show the student exactly how the full range of exam questions can be approached.
Table of Contents
Introduction. Cognitive Psychology: Memory. Developmental Psychology: Early Social Development. Research Methods. Biological Psychology: Stress. Social Psychology: Social Influence. Individual Differences: Psychopathology.
